GR8 idea , but takes some time to assemble and make it "operational" . Batteries fit in to back of switch , which is gritty and difficult to turn ON and OFF . Caliber arbors to fit onto laser body are held onto body with tiny screws that do not readily screw through the arbors . Took a major amount of time to thread them . Once screwed onto body , must adjust screw tension on arbor to fit bore and hold body in place . There is no "recommended" distance to align scope to bore axis . Performed alignment in basement at 40 feet , rifle retained in Caldwell cleaning base . Laser bright on supplied target , aligned reticles vertically and horizontally to ZERO . Verified next day at 25 yard range . Should have taken LaserLyte with me , but did not . First , and second confirming shots were 6 inches high and 2.5 inches left . "On the paper" , but I expected better . Would recommend removal of batteries for safe storage . This test was done on a Ruger 10/22 with a Bushnell Trophy 4x10x40 . It now shoots half inch groups consistently with SK Standard Plus .

Purchased a new unit to replace my "old" unit which worked perfectly.....until the switch wore out or a solder joint went bad after 4 years. Didn't know it had a 3 year warranty or I could have sent it back after the first sign of the switch going bad. I had to adjust the old one once to recenter the beam and it was pretty easy to do, had instructions for it as well. New unit did not have instructions on centering the beam and the company epoxied the adjustment screws in place. I checked new unit for center. It was an inch off at 8 feet - that's a 2" circle at 8 ft. Do the math and you wouldn't even be on the paper at 50 YARDS. I wouldn't give a plugged nickle for the new units. I narrowed down my switch issue with my old unit to the spring that rides against the batteries. I'm a design engineer and expert shooter so I know what I'm talking about. If you have a fix, please advise. I contacted the company and got that I did everything they would do to get it to fire up correctly then told to just purchase a new one. Of course, I waited like 7 or 8 years which I can't gripe much about, but a switch like this to go bad? I've also done endurance testing on components and assemblies and never had a switch wear out like this. Would not recommend getting this unit no matter how many say it's one of the best. Well, it isn't good enough for the money.
